I have a Sony Cyber-shot model DSCP31. When I went to use it the other day, the screen is black. The pictures that were stored previously can be seen, but the screen is black on all the other settings. Can anyone help me???

Remove the batteries from the camera, wait 20 minutes, then reinstall them. Any difference? Don't worry - you won't lose your pictures, they are stored on non-volatile memory.
